    I had thought that I had mentioned this somewhere when the competition was running, but might just be remembering the Milk Magazine's 2011 Deluxe Optimus competition. (or I just can't find the news posting)

    Well, the Hong Kong fashion magazine called "Milk" (trendy magazines have such weird names), had been running another Transformers movie toy competition... this time for the Voyager Evasion Optimus toy, with hand-painted "dirt" so that it is Gen1 red, but old like in the movie (which was instead a white truck).

    Anyway, it seems that the competition is over, and word is that there may have only been three of these.
    A gallery of one has been shown here, with four of the seven other Voyager Optimus decos that have so far been released (Hasbro regular, Evolutions, JP ToysRUs Rusty, JP Expo Nemesis - missing Platinum, JP Advanced & Breakout Scene).
    The Milk Magazine version in robot mode certainly looks like a toy found in the backyard sandpit after about 10 years... so I think the truck mode is probably the better looking mode.


    This is probably my favourite mould of the TF4 toys (because of the alt-mode), so I'm not liking that, so far only one of the eight is a general release figure here, with the others being costly (or hard to get) exclusives.
    I may not ever get this one, or the JP Nemesis version (based on the prices on ebay so far), but am keen to get most of the others though... and any other colours they want to do it in.
